5.30.2005If a recruiter asks where else I'm interviewing, do I tell them?
"Unless you know and trust a recruiter, you have no idea what he may do with
information about other jobs you're pursuing. I've seen recruiters go out of their way to torpedo an opportunity a person was developing, just so the recruiter could advance his own deal. It's unlikely you'd encounter that nasty a recruiter, but you must be careful all the time. Don't divulge other opportunities you're working on if you're not sure about the recruiter. Keep your standards high. Deal only with recruiters who behave like your interests matter as much as their own.
